Best tide state to fish North Beach Jetty
West-facing position with the jetty extending into the Marmion Marine Park reef system. Fishes well in most weather short of strong westerlies. Calm before the easterly fades. Tide changes drive the bream and tailor bite; slack water is slow. Water clarity is excellent in the marine park year-round; reduces only in the days after winter storms. The compact jetty means you're always within casting distance of structure.
What anglers target here
Anglers fishing North Beach Jetty typically time sessions around the tide for australian herring, king george whiting, tailor, skipjack trevally (skippy), and southern calamari (squid).
